Terracotta fragment of a neck-amphora (jar)
Painter of Vatican 365
540–530 BCE · Terracotta · Greek and Roman Art

Tendrils and a palmette; warrior to right wearing a red chiton with a patterned border, holding his spear in his left hand and his helmet in his right; woman to right, wearing a peplos ornamented with stars on the top of the garment, and red dots on the skirt; helmeted warrior to right, wearing a himation with red and black folds
